Swagger UI:Trunkit API 文档生成与交互指南

下载需积分: 9 | ZIP格式 | 1.17MB | 更新于2024-10-29 | 83 浏览量 | 0 下载量 举报
收藏
知识点: 1. Swagger UI:Swagger UI是Swagger项目的一部分,Swagger项目允许用户生成、可视化和使用自己的RESTful服务。Swagger UI是一个HTML、Javascript和CSS资源的无依赖集合,可以从符合Swagger的API动态生成漂亮的文档和沙箱。因为Swagger UI没有任何依赖项,所以可以将其托管在任何服务器环境或本地计算机上。 2. Swagger:Swagger的目标是为REST API定义一个标准的、与语言无关的接口,它允许人类和计算机在不访问源代码、文档或通过网络流量检查的情况下发现和理解服务的功能。当通过Swagger正确定义时,消费者可以使用最少的实现逻辑理解远程服务并与之交互。Swagger消除了调用接口为低级编程所做的类似工作。 3. RESTful服务:RESTful服务是一种网络服务,它遵循REST架构风格。REST是一种软件架构风格,它定义了一系列原则和约束,这些原则和约束被用来创建Web服务,这些Web服务是可读的、灵活的,并且可以通过标准HTTP方法进行交互。 4. HTML、Javascript和CSS:HTML是用于创建网页的标记语言,Javascript是一种脚本语言,用于在浏览器中实现交互性和动态效果,CSS是一种样式表语言,用于定义HTML文档的外观和格式。 5. API:API是应用程序编程接口的缩写,它是一组预定义的函数、协议和工具,用于构建软件和应用程序。API允许不同的软件组件之间进行通信。 6. 沙箱:沙箱是一个安全的、受限制的执行环境,它允许用户运行程序或代码,而不会影响到系统的其他部分。在API文档的上下文中,沙箱是一个允许用户测试API调用的环境。 7. 无依赖集:在软件开发中,无依赖集指的是一个软件组件或库不依赖于其他组件或库。这使得组件或库可以在任何环境中运行,而不需要其他的依赖项。 8. Swagger UI的安装和使用:Swagger UI可以通过npm(Node包管理器)进行安装。安装完成后,需要将符合Swagger规范的API定义文件(通常是JSON或YAML格式)提供给Swagger UI,Swagger UI会自动解析这个文件并生成漂亮的API文档和沙箱。 9. Swagger的使用和优势:Swagger可以用于API的设计、文档化和测试。通过Swagger,开发者可以清晰地了解API的结构和功能,而无需访问源代码或文档。这大大简化了API的使用和集成过程。 10. REST API的定义和使用:REST API是一种网络服务,它遵循REST架构风格,允许用户通过HTTP协议进行交互。通过定义REST API,开发者可以创建可读的、灵活的和易于使用的网络服务。

相关推荐

手机看
程序员都在用的中文IT技术交流社区

程序员都在用的中文IT技术交流社区

专业的中文 IT 技术社区,与千万技术人共成长

专业的中文 IT 技术社区,与千万技术人共成长

关注【CSDN】视频号,行业资讯、技术分享精彩不断,直播好礼送不停!

关注【CSDN】视频号,行业资讯、技术分享精彩不断,直播好礼送不停!

客服 返回
顶部